A Healthcare Policy Advisor in Digital Innovation works at the intersection of healthcare policy and technology. This role involves crafting policies that support the integration of digital solutions in healthcare systems to improve patient outcomes and operational efficiency.
Key Responsibilities
Analyze current healthcare policies and assess their impact on digital innovation.
Develop strategies to implement digital health technologies within regulatory frameworks.
Collaborate with healthcare providers, tech companies, and government agencies.
Advocate for policy changes that promote digital health advancements.
Monitor trends in healthcare technology to inform policy development.
